I still think there's too much going on in this one patch. It refactors i915 and modifies xe behaviour in one go. It adds intel_plane_caps.[ch] in i915, but extracts them from skl+ specific functions and files. xe uses the .h but adds the code in existing xe_plane_initial.c. There's also intel_plane_initial.c i915 side, but that's not where the functions get moved in i915 side. I'm trying to look at the actual functional change, and I'm wondering if it isn't just this: index 511dc1544854..8bba6c2e5098 100644 --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/skl_universal_plane.c +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/skl_universal_plane.c @@ -2290,6 +2290,9 @@ static u8 skl_get_plane_caps(struct drm_i915_private = *i915, if (HAS_4TILE(i915)) caps |=3D INTEL_PLANE_CAP_TILING_4; =20 + if (!IS_ENABLED(I915) && !HAS_FLAT_CCS(i915)) + return caps; + if (skl_plane_has_rc_ccs(i915, pipe, plane_id)) { caps |=3D INTEL_PLANE_CAP_CCS_RC; if (DISPLAY_VER(i915) >=3D 12) I'm not saying that's exactly pretty, either, but IIUC this is supposed to be a temporary measure ("until they are fixed"), I'd rather take this small thing instead.
